Central Route vs. Peripheral Route of Persuasion in Advertising

Logos, ethos, and pathos are key components of persuasive techniques used in advertising. In the case of Bliss Soda, an ad utilizing the central route of persuasion would focus on logical reasons like reduced calorie content and health benefits, while a peripheral route ad might emphasize attractive people enjoying the product on a beach without much logical reasoning. The effectiveness of persuasion can be seen in how products like Coca-Cola become ingrained in daily life through memories and cultural acceptance.
